Welsh Railway Sheep Dog (1939)

Tan-y-Bwlch, Wales. Miss Betty Jones (sp?) in Welsh national costume giving out pieces of paper to passengers through the train window. Cut to a locomotive and back to Miss Jones. Train leaving the station, Miss Jones looking on. Miss Jones is station master, inspector, booking clerk and porter. Close up shot of a sheep dog surrounded by people at another station in Wales. His name is Ginger Jack and his role is to keep sheep and cows off the track. Several shots of Ginger Jack at work. FILM ID:1266.3 A VIDEO FROM BRITISH PATHÉ.
